The first ever 12-step recovery program exclusively for women has opened its doors inside the Midnight Mission. Twelve private rooms will house up to 24 women at a time enrolled in a 6-to-18 month residential recovery program. There’ll be 24/7 support from an all-female staff and programs offered include therapy, case management, legal advocacy and peer counseling. The Clare E. Women’s Recovery Center was created to help women on skid row escape the abuse, addiction and trauma of the streets.
